Disaster Recovery Team to Visit Disaster Affected Counties 

Release Date: July 12, 2000
Release Number: 1334-06

» More Information on North Dakota Severe Storms And Flooding

Bismarck, ND -- Disaster recovery teams will visit ten communities over the next three weeks to provide information to individuals who have been affected by the severe storms, flooding and ground saturation beginning April 5. The teams will be located at:

Team members will assist applicants from 9:00 a.m. until 6:00 p.m.

Residents are invited to visit the disaster recovery team at the location most convenient to them. Depending on need, the Disaster Recovery Team may revisit a location.

Representatives of state and federal agencies will be present. The disaster programs available include temporary housing, individual and family grants, disaster unemployment assistance, low-interest loans from the U.S. Small Business Administration for homeowners, renters or business owners, and other aid programs.

If you have sustained damages to your home or business from the storms and flooding, you are encouraged to register for assistance using FEMA's toll-free number: 1-800-462-9029 before visiting the team. TTY 1-800-462-7585 for the speech- or hearing-impaired. Recovery specialists are available to take calls from 8 a.m. to 6 p.m., daily.
